Cub Scouts Spookoree Haunted Woods 2025
Spookoree Haunted Woods 2025 at CSD October 24-26, 2025
A fun filled day for the whole family at Camp Sidney Dew.
Events will be held on the Lake Goodyear side of the camp, near Blackfoot Shelter. All programs will be centrally located in this area to help minimize travel between program stations.
The official schedule for the day’s activities for your group will be given to your unit at check-in.
Some activities will be available:
BB Range Haunted Hayrides
Archery Range Field Games
Art Activities Crafts
Scout Skills Unit Camping
Gaga Ball Much more….
Unit camping will be allowed for 2 nights on October 24th and 25st. Units may choose to camp only Friday night, only Saturday night, or both nights. Units will need to choose their camping nights during the event registration process located in products with additional patches, Campsites will be assigned by event staff based on unit size and any medical needs.
The registration fee for each youth attending (ages 3 and up) is $20 and each adult is $5.00. The youth registration fee includes a patch and all activities on Saturday. Parents who wish to purchase (additional) patches may do so for $5 per patch at registration while supplies last.
Registration closes October 10th at midnight.
NOTE: All registration fees need to be paid online at the time registration. If a unit needs to pay at the Scout Office in person, please have all registration information including participants in the NWGA Tentaroo Cart prior to arriving at the office. No payments will be accepted at the gate during the day of the event.
Late Registration Fees:
Any registration submitted after midnight on October 10th will be charged an addition $5.00 per person. Youth fees increase to $25.00 and Adult/leader fees increase to $10.00 till October 17th.

Cub Scouts Sasquatch Trek Webelos and AOL 2025
Sasquatch Trek Webelos and AOL 2025
Thank you for considering Sasquatch Trek: Webelos & AOL Outdoor
Adventure—an exciting and purpose-driven weekend designed to prepare our
Webelos and Arrow of Light Scouts for their next big step into the world of
Scouts BSA.
As these young Scouts stand at the edge of transition, our goal is to give
them a fun, challenging, and engaging experience that introduces key elements
of what’s ahead. Sasquatch Trek is built to reinforce core Scout skills while
introducing the patrol method, which is central to the Scouts BSA program.
Whether it's navigating trails, cooking together, working through
challenges, or just learning to function as a team, each activity is crafted to build
confidence, leadership, and camaraderie. This weekend is more than just an
outdoor adventure—it's a stepping stone. We want these Scouts to leave camp
not only with mud on their boots and stories to tell, but with a clearer
understanding of what it means to be part of a patrol, take ownership of their
journey, and live by the Scout Oath and Law.
This will be a great weekend full of adventure, growth, and maybe even a
few signs of the elusive Sasquatch!
